Question 144377: I am tring to do the final worksheet of the term and I just don't understand it well enough to take the final. If anyone can help me with these equations I would really appreciate it. I have to find the vertex and intercepts and graph the equation.
f(x)= -2x^2-5x+3

First we will factor:
f(x)=-(x+3)(2x-1).
Find the intercepts first:
y-intercept:
f(0)=-(3)(-1)=3. That gives (0,3).
x-intercepts:
0=-(x+3)(2x-1) implies x=-3 or x=1/2. That gives (-3,0) and (1/2,0)
